About Shoreham-by-Sea

Shoreham-by-Sea, a charming coastal town, offers a delightful blend of maritime history, natural beauty, and artistic flair. Nestled on the Sussex coast, where the River Adur meets the English Channel, it boasts a vibrant harbor, picturesque beaches, and a rich cultural scene. Visitors can explore the historic harbor, enjoy watersports, or wander through the town's art galleries and independent shops.

The town's appeal extends beyond its scenic location. Shoreham-by-Sea is known for its friendly atmosphere and welcoming community. The area is also a haven for wildlife, with opportunities for birdwatching and nature walks. With its easy access to Brighton and other coastal towns, Shoreham-by-Sea makes an excellent base for exploring the South Coast.

Shoreham-by-Sea FAQ

What are the main attractions in Shoreham-by-Sea?

Key attractions include Shoreham Harbour, the historic town center with its independent shops and art galleries, Shoreham Beach, and the nearby South Downs National Park. The Ropetackle Arts Centre also offers a variety of performances and events.

How accessible is Shoreham-by-Sea?

Shoreham-by-Sea is easily accessible by train, with regular services from London and other major towns. It is also well-connected by road, with the A27 providing access to the town. The town center is walkable, and there are local bus services available.

What kind of activities can I do in Shoreham-by-Sea?

Visitors can enjoy a range of activities, including watersports such as sailing and paddleboarding, exploring the harbor and beaches, visiting art galleries and museums, walking and cycling along the coast and in the South Downs, and attending events at the Ropetackle Arts Centre.
